Authorities have once again warned of tough action against reckless drivers and those who deliberately violate traffic rules.
The latest reminder comes after a motorist was arrested in Sharjah for performing stunts on Madam-Al Shuwaib Road that led to an accident.
He was arrested within hours of the video of the stunts going viral on social media.
Police said the clip dates back to the second day of Eid Al Fitr (May 25).
Two teenagers were arrested in Abu Dhabi recently for a similar offence during the Eid holidays.
Motorists caught driving recklessly face a fine of AED 2,000 and 23 black points, in addition to their vehicle being impounded for up to 60 days.
